OnePlus foldable phone ‘Open’ is jointly developed by OPPO team and OnePlus team, the company confirms

Anushka Sharma was recently spotted using the OnePlus Open smartphone even before its official debut.

OnePlus today officially confirmed that its first foldable phone Open and Oppo Find N3 will be the same. According to the company the Oppo Find N3 will be rebranded to OnePlus Open. So the specs of the OnePlus foldable will be similar to those of Oppo’s. The device will feature a triple rear camera setup

OnePlus has revealed that Pete Lau Founder of OnePlus and Senior Vice President and Chief Product Officer of OPPO directed his teams at OnePlus and OPPO to work together to bring the best of both brands to the new phone. OnePlus further revealed the evolution of the new device’s hinge and revealed that the new product will feature the OnePlus trademark Alert Slider.

The OnePlus foldable phone Open will be launched in select overseas markets soon.
“Because we want to create a synergy and bring the best of the two teams together. Both teams have accumulated strong experience, and this folding phone will have a different go-to-market strategy in different regions so that more users will be able to have their hands on this device,” the company said.

There will probably be a circular camera module on the OnePlus Open. The camera system is likely to be tuned by Hasselblad. Bollywood actress Anushka Sharma was recently spotted holding the devices, suggesting that the foldable phone may soon be available here.

OnePlus Open was unveiled by YouTuber Lewis Hilsenteger while he interviewed Pete Lau. The folding phone will have a new hinge system made out of very less components in comparison to the Oppo Find N2.

Most probably, the OnePlus Open will make its debut this month. As per a previous report official premiere might occur on October 19.

- Advertisement -

“Our foldable phone goes beyond offering a large-screen experience. It embodies a lightweight and slim design, a powerful camera, and delivers a fast and seamless user experience. Only when all these aspects are perfectly balanced can we truly call it a flagship foldable phone,” the company has also confirmed.
